Output e693873b99a48166d42a9f3d4e7d6b0e09f797f7032022923b056a0fbb882674:59

value
42760
script pubkey
OP_0 OP_PUSHBYTES_20 c2a75bbff648ac6120ceba80823ecebdc0cb9dbf
address
bc1qc2n4h0lkfzkxzgxwh2qgy0kwhhqvh8dl4sq76m
transaction
e693873b99a48166d42a9f3d4e7d6b0e09f797f7032022923b056a0fbb882674
confirmations
173753
spent
false

1 Sat Range